#1d36be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1d36be is composed of 11.4% red, 21.2% green and 74.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.7% cyan, 71.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 25.5% black. It has a hue angle of 230.7 degrees, a saturation of 73.5% and a lightness of 42.9%. #1d36be color hex could be obtained by blending #3a6cff with #00007d. Closest websafe color is: #3333cc.

Shades and Tints of #1d36be

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000103 is the darkest color, while #f1f3f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1d36be

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#696a72 is the less saturated color, while #0425d7 is the most saturated one.
